杜鸿飞(博士)

创始人兼CEO 北京航空航天大学电子工程系,英国萨里大学电子工程硕士(Msc),哲学硕士(MPhil),博士(PhD)。曾发表国际知名期刊会议论文40余篇,国际标准化提案20余篇,国内国际专利20余篇,软件著作权10余篇。曾任加拿大SimonFraser University,英国University of Surrey大学,清华大学博士生导师兼特聘海外专家。

曾受聘于英国Volantis,意大利CREATE-NET, Alcatel-Lucent贝尔实验室(高级研发工程师), 美国IDCC(高级嵌入式软件工程师), 曾参与3GPP国际标准化制定, 负责主持多个欧盟FP大型协作研发项目,参与法国国防部涉密卫星通信研发项目,主持研发中国高铁高精度单坐标卡脖子涉密项目,参与中国空间技术研究院,空空导弹研究所等多个军工涉密研发制造项目, 自2018年起开始涉及高精度三坐标测头软硬件研发,2025年创立苏州普莱格科技担任执行总经理,从事国家卡脖子技术超高精度三坐标测量机核心技术的软件与探测系统专项研究开发。
